Size: 4-1/4" (108 mm) The Safari series knives were made for heavy duty use. Compared to other Swiss Army knives, each tool is longer because of the length of the knife, and the saw and blade are twice as thick. It is the seller's information that the only difference between this knife and the one issued to the West German Army is that the Army version had the German Eagle on the handle instead of the name plate. Features : olive drab checkered nylon handle with lanyard hole and name plate area, the deeply checkered handle provides a non-slip grip, large blade, all-purpose saw with bottle opener and screwdriver, punch with reamer, corkscrew.
